    RKIP contains a novel phospho-amino acid binding domain. Substitutions in the ligand binding site of RKIP compromise the stability of the phosphorylated Raf-RKIP complex. Notably, PKM2 binds directly and selectively to tyrosine (Tyr, Y)-phosphorylated peptides, and expression of the phosphotyrosine-binding form of PKM2 is required for the rapid growth of cancer cells (1).
